In 2020-2021, 260 degrees and certificates were awarded to mathematics students who went to a Louisiana college or university. This makes it the #41 most popular major in the state.

Our 2023 rankings named Tulane University of Louisiana the most popular school in Louisiana for mathematics students working on their bachelor’s degree. Tulane is a fairly large private not-for-profit school located in the city of New Orleans.
Women make up 46% of the math majors at the school.

The in-demand bachelor’s degree programs at Louisiana State University and Agricultural & Mechanical College hel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the most popular mathematics schools in Louisiana. Located in the midsize city of Baton Rouge, Louisiana State University is a public college with a very large student population.
Of the 36 students majoring in math at Louisiana State University, 47% are male and 53% are female.
The average amount in student loans that math majors at Louisiana State University take out while working on their Bachelor's Degree is $18,220.

Out of the 20 schools in Louisiana that were part of this year’s ranking, Louisiana Tech University landed the # 4 spot on the list. Located in the town of Ruston, Louisiana Tech is a public college with a fairly large student population.
Of the 10 students majoring in math at Louisiana Tech, 50% are male and 50% are female.
After completing their Bachelor's Degree, math graduates from Louisiana Tech carry an average student debt load of $21,571.

A rank of #5 on this year’s list means Southern University at New Orleans is a great place for mathematics students working on their bachelor’s degree. Located in the city of New Orleans, SUNO is a public college with a small student population.
Of the 8 students majoring in math at SUNO, 25% are male and 75% are female.
After completing their Bachelor's Degree, math graduates from SUNO carry an average student debt load of $43,308.
